Senior Signal Processing Engineer
Job Description
Job Description
Camgian is looking to expand its development organization with the addition of a Senior Signal Processing Engineer to develop innovative technologies for our products. We are focused on applying state-of-the-art computational technologies, Artificial Intelligence, Machine Learning, Deep Learning, and Computer Vision to advance decision support products in the government and commercial markets. This is a hands-on technical position that involves the architecture, design and development of signal processing algorithms. The candidate must demonstrate strong programming, physics, and mathematical skills and be able to solve complex problems. Strong leadership and communication skills with the ability to lead small to mid-sized technical teams are required.
Qualifications
Bachelor’s degree in Computer Engineering, Electrical Engineering, or Computer Science
Proficient in C/C++, Python
Proficient in scientific computing tools such as NumPy, SciPy, Pandas, Matplotlib, Scikit-learn, MATLAB
Strong background in sensor and image signal processing techniques
Experience in detection, classification, angle of arrival, and tracking algorithms
Experience with sensor fusion, state estimation, random signals, feature extraction, and linear algebra
Experience in designing, implementing, and optimizing signal processing algorithms for a product
10+ years of experience in signal processing algorithm development
United States Citizenship
Desired Skills
Strong analytical skills and experience in areas of adaptive filter theory, spectral estimation, detection and estimation theory, linear algebra and/or stochastic processes
Experience solving complex signal processing, detection, estimation and tracking related problems
Experience with radar and acoustic sensor theory, and motion-based detection techniques
Familiarity with machine learning and deep learning concepts
Responsibilities
Architect system level design solutions with customer requirements, schedule, and budget in mind
Breakdown large problems into a sequence of tasks for execution with the appropriate level of effort, key milestones, deliverables, and risks
Document architecture, design, test plan, results, and analysis
Prepare and conduct technical presentations to effectively communicate ideas, issues, and solutions to diverse groups in the company including Engineers, Product & Business Development, CTO, CEO
Lead small to mid-sized technical teams to develop algorithms for deployment in products
Serve as a strong mentor to junior engineers to develop their skills and confidence
Contribute to continuous process and productivity improvements in the team
Exceptional work ethic, willingness to learn, tenacity not to quit, aptitude to surpass, and strong desire to work in a fast-paced environment are necessary for success. Collaboration and cross pollination with other teams will be frequent; thus communication, openness, and willingness to share both success and failure is a must. We are a team-centric organization, there are no individuals, we win and lose together.
Camgian offers a competitive salary, fun work environment, fringe benefits, and an equity opportunity.
Camgian Culture and Core Value Traits
Ability to work as part of a team while maintaining independent thinking
Self-driven and self-starter in addition to excellent communication skills
Thinking outside the box and an aptitude for innovation and problem solving
Always willing to explore the other side of fear, be challenged and to crave cutting edge technologies
Powered by JazzHR
4YwXrfp4qi
Recommended Jobs
Door and Window Installers
Job Description Job Description Stellar Staffing, LLC is currently accepting applications for a Door/Window Installer. Will be installing doors and windows in residential homes. Must have prio…
Security Officer - Healthcare Patrols - Full Time
Job Description Job Description Overview Allied Universal®, North America's leading security and facility services company, provides rewarding careers that give you a sense of purpose. While wor…
Customer Programs Manager
Job Description Job Description New Flyer is North America's heavy-duty transit bus leader and offers the most advanced product line under the Xcelsior® and Xcelsior CHARGE® brands. It also offe…
Scenario Designer
Job Description Job Description Scenerio Designer Company Overview: KODA is a people-first company recognized as a six-time winner of Huntsville's Best Places to Work® Award, certified …
District Sales Manager
NOW HIRING! Metal Building Industry District Sales Manager, PEMB (Territory: AL, MS, GA, TN) We’re looking for a proven sales leader in the Pre-Engineered Metal Building (PEMB) indust…
Restaurant Manager - Hotel Italian Grill
Job Title: Restaurant Manager Location: Tennessee Property: Italian Grill Luxury Hotel Company: Marvin Love and Associates Compensation: $65,000.00 Job Summary: Marvin Love and Assoc…
Warehouse Associate
Job Description Warehouse Associate PeopleReady of Birmingham, AL is now hiring Warehouse Associates in Hueytown, AL! As a Warehouse Associate, you will pick, pack, and prepare orders for shipp…
Customer Service Rep(5852) - 2304 Columbiana Road
Job Description Job Description Company Description We have fun and create opportunities for our team members! Job Description Domino’s Customer Service Reps perform customer service …
Orthopaedic Spine Surgeon | SportsMED | Huntsville, Alabama
Job Description Job Description Spine Surgeon Opportunity – Huntsville, AL Join an outstanding orthopaedic team with SportsMED Orthopaedic Specialists. Position Overview SportsMED is act…